Understanding WAR and xG
WAR is a comprehensive statistic that estimates a player’s overall contribution to their team compared to a replacement-level player. It considers various aspects such as offense, defense, and overall impact. xG, on the other hand, measures the quality of scoring chances in soccer, predicting how many goals a player should have scored based on the quality of shots taken.
Why Use These Metrics in Fantasy Sports?
Traditional stats like goals, assists, or points can be misleading or fail to capture a player’s true value. Advanced metrics like WAR and xG offer a more nuanced view. For example, a player with high xG but few goals might be poised for a breakout, while WAR can highlight players who contribute significantly beyond basic stats.
Applying WAR in Fantasy Baseball
In fantasy baseball, WAR helps identify players who contribute across multiple categories. Players with high WAR are often more consistent and reliable. Tracking WAR trends over the season can also reveal emerging stars or underrated players.
Using xG in Fantasy Soccer
For soccer fantasy leagues, xG provides insight into a player’s scoring potential. Players with high xG are likely to score more goals in the future, making them valuable picks. Monitoring xG can also help you identify players involved in many quality scoring chances, even if they haven’t scored yet.
